How they compare

Thailand currently reports 1.01 against 1 in Kazakhstan, a difference of 0.01.

The two have swapped places 5 times across 24 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Kazakhstan ahead.

Kazakhstan ranks 26th and Thailand ranks 23rd of 179 countries.

Across the 3 decades both report, Kazakhstan averaged higher in 2 and Thailand in 1.
